Last week we watched Episode 2 of the John Adams mini-series called "Independence." I think this movie did an excellent job of capturing the mood of many of the Founding Fathers regarding whether or not to declare independence from Great Britain. I hope you enjoyed it.

I think John Adams also serves as a reminder that history is much more complex than we sometimes make it out to be. America declared its independence and fought in the Revolutionary War, but not everyone agreed it was the right thing to do and many people's lives did not change after the War. However, it remains a significant event because of the events that led to it and how it changed and shaped, and continues to shape, America's development.
